Understanding Air Filter Basics: How They Work and Why They Matter

Air filters clean the air circulating through your HVAC system by trapping particles as air passes through a fibrous or porous material. The goal is twofold: protect your HVAC equipment from debris (prolonging its lifespan) and improve the air you breathe. Poor IAQ has been linked to respiratory issues, allergies, fatigue, and even long-term health problems, making a reliable filter non-negotiable for most households.

Before diving into “best” options, it’s essential to grasp two key concepts: ​particle capture efficiency​ and ​airflow resistance. Filters must trap harmful particles without restricting airflow too much—otherwise, your HVAC system works harder, increasing energy costs and potentially causing damage. This balance is measured by industry-standard ratings we’ll explore next.

Key Ratings to Evaluate Air Filter Performance

To compare filters objectively, focus on these metrics:

1. MERV (Minimum Efficiency Reporting Value)​

Developed by the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E), MERV rates a filter’s ability to capture particles between 0.3 and 10 microns. The scale ranges from 1 (basic) to 20 (hospital-grade). Most residential filters fall between MERV 8 and MERV 13:

  • MERV 8–10: Catches larger particles like pollen, dust mites, and mold spores. Good for homes without severe allergies.

  • MERV 11–13: Traps smaller particles, including pet dander, fine dust, and some bacteria. Ideal for families with allergies or asthma.

  • MERV 14–20: Reserved for commercial or medical settings; too dense for most home HVAC systems, as they restrict airflow.

2. CADR (Clean Air Delivery Rate)​

Certified by the Association of Home Appliance Manufacturers (AHAM), CADR measures how quickly a filter removes specific pollutants: smoke (small particles), dust, and pollen. Higher CADR numbers (up to 450 for smoke, 400 for dust/pollen) mean faster, more thorough cleaning. This is especially useful for large rooms or open floor plans.

3. MPPS (Most Penetrating Particle Size)​

This lesser-known metric identifies the particle size a filter struggles most to capture—usually around 0.1–0.3 microns. High-efficiency filters (like HEPA) are tested to ensure they trap ≥99.97% of particles at this size, making them highly effective against viruses and ultrafine particles.

Types of Air Filters: Pros, Cons, and Best Uses

Not all filters are created equal. Here’s a breakdown of the most common types, ranked by performance and suitability for homes:

1. Fiberglass Filters (MERV 1–4)​

  • How they work: Thin, disposable panels with layered fiberglass fibers that trap large particles.

  • Pros: Inexpensive (5), low airflow resistance.

  • Cons: Only capture 10–20% of particles; do little for allergens or fine dust.

  • Best for: Homes prioritizing HVAC protection over air quality; rarely recommended as the “best air filter” for health.

2. Pleated Filters (MERV 5–13)​

  • How they work: Folded polyester or cotton pleats increase surface area, improving particle capture.

  • Pros: Better than fiberglass—MERV 8–11 models trap 80–95% of common allergens. Affordable (20).

  • Cons: Higher MERV ratings (12–13) may restrict airflow in older HVAC systems.

  • Best for: Most homes; a solid mid-range choice for general dust, pollen, and pet dander.

3. HEPA Filters (MERV 17–20)​

  • How they work: Dense mats of randomly arranged fibers trap 99.97% of particles ≥0.3 microns, including viruses, bacteria, and smoke. True HEPA filters meet strict ISO standards.

  • Pros: Gold standard for air purification; critical for allergy/asthma sufferers or homes with smokers.

  • Cons: Higher cost (50+); may require HVAC modifications (some systems can’t handle the pressure drop). Portable HEPA purifiers are a workaround.

  • Best for: Families with respiratory issues, pet owners, or those in high-pollution areas. A top pick for the “best air filter” if your budget and system allow.

4. Activated Carbon Filters

  • How they work: Porous carbon adsorbs gases, odors, and VOCs (from paints, cleaning products, or cooking). Often combined with HEPA or pleated filters.

  • Pros: Effective for chemical sensitivity or homes with strong odors.

  • Cons: Limited particle-trapping ability; carbon saturates over time (needs frequent replacement).

  • Best for: Supplementing primary filters in kitchens, homes with smokers, or areas with high VOC exposure.

5. Electrostatic/Electronic Filters

  • How they work: Use static electricity to attract particles to charged plates. Washable and reusable.

  • Pros: No ongoing filter costs; good for large particles.

  • Cons: Less effective for submicron particles; can produce trace ozone (a lung irritant) if poorly designed.

  • Best for: Budget-conscious households without severe allergy needs; avoid if ozone sensitivity is a concern.

Matching Your Filter to Your Home’s Needs

The “best air filter” for you depends on your unique situation. Ask these questions:

Do you or a family member have allergies/asthma?​

Prioritize HEPA (MERV 17+) or high-MERV (13) pleated filters. Look for certifications like Asthma and Allergy Friendly™.

Do you have pets?​

Pet dander is 2–4 microns—MERV 11–13 filters trap most of it. Add activated carbon if odors are an issue.

Is your home in a polluted area or do you cook/smoke indoors?​

HEPA filters handle smoke particles (0.1–0.3 microns), while carbon filters reduce cooking odors and VOCs.

Do you have an older HVAC system?​

Avoid high-MERV (13+) or HEPA filters—they may cause airflow issues. Stick to MERV 8–11 pleated filters.

Sizing Matters: How to Choose the Right Filter Dimensions

Even the best air filter won’t work if it doesn’t fit. Most HVAC systems use standard sizes (e.g., 16x20x1, 20x25x4), but always check your existing filter or HVAC manual. Measure length, width, and thickness (depth) to ensure a tight seal—gaps let unfiltered air bypass the filter. If you’re unsure, consult an HVAC professional.

Installation and Maintenance: Maximizing Your Filter’s Lifespan

  • Installation: Remove the old filter, note the airflow direction (marked “AIR FLOW” or an arrow), and insert the new filter with the arrow pointing toward the furnace/AC unit.

  • Replacement Frequency:

    • Fiberglass: Every 30 days.

    • Pleated: Every 90 days (more often if you have pets or allergies).

    • HEPA/Carbon: Every 6–12 months (follow manufacturer guidelines).

  • Cleaning Reusable Filters: Electrostatic models can be vacuumed or washed with water—let them dry fully before reinstalling.

Debunking Common Myths About Air Filters

  • Myth 1: Higher MERV = Always Better

    Truth: A MERV 14 filter may damage an older HVAC system by restricting airflow. Balance efficiency with system compatibility.

  • Myth 2: Electronic Filters Are Safer

    Truth: Many produce ozone, which the EPA warns can cause respiratory irritation. HEPA or pleated filters are safer bets.

  • Myth 3: All Filters Remove Viruses

    Truth: Only HEPA (MERV 17+) and MERV 16+ filters reliably capture viruses (which are ~0.1 microns but often attach to larger droplets).
